4 Signs Your Affton Home Needs Sewer Line Repairs

Broken sewer lines can show different signs, even for the same cause, for homes in Affton, MO. But there are some common warning signs to be aware of. Common indicators fall into one of the following buckets – if you're noticing one or (especially) multiple symptoms, give us a call so we can perform an inspection and/or sewer repair:

  1. Drains Backing Up, particularly if you see it in the basement. When water is backflowing out of multiple drains in your house, this is a clear indicator that deep in your plumbing is causing issues (in many cases, your sewer line). You see this the most often in your basement because plumbing systems usually drain waste down before sending it out into the sewer.
  2. Nasty Odors near your drains or at spots in your lawn. A rotten or fecal smell is a key giveaway that you need sewer repair services. This can occur around drains because of sewage backups, and in your yard if there is a leak in the sewer pipe running underground.
  3. Persistent Wet Spots in your lawn, and especially green areas of grass. As indicated in point 2, when your sewer line under your yard is cracked, sewage flows up into it. The wet spots frequently will congregate around the break. And the grass becomes a more vivid shade of green as it absorbs nutrients from the sewage.
  4. Long-Lasting Gurgles when you flush or send water down your drains. Gurgling noises show up as air within your pipes tries to find a way out. A small amount is normal, but long-lasting and repeatedfrequent gurgling might be a sign that a damaged line somewhere in your home's plumbing allowing air to enter the pipes. If the gurgling always seems to be there, no matter which appliance you're using, the damage might be in your sewer line.

Repeat and Widespread Drain Issues

You might have read the list above and thought to yourself, "How can I tell if that's because of a sewer issue or an appliance problem?" And that's a great question – at face value, most of the signs are similar. But the key distinction is the location of and frequency that problems show up in your home.

If you notice these symptoms more at lower levels in your home, it increases the chances that your sewer is the part that needs repairs. Because wastewater ordinally flows down and out of your home by or through the basement, if something's wrong with the sewer line, it will be more noticeable there. However, main sewer line problems also tend to show widespread symptoms, so if you're detecting the same issue (odor, gurgling, etc.) is occurring in multiple appliances, there's an increased likelihood that you will need a sewer repair.

Relatedly, if the issues keep coming back, it's more likely to be a sewer problem. Cleaning or fixing an individual appliance only helps if it's the actual site of the issue.

How Do Sewer Line Repairs Work?

There are many ways to conduct a sewer repair in Affton, MO, and picking the right one is important to save you stress and money. Fortunately, aaccomplished master plumber will be able to guide you through what options are best for your home.

Assessing the situation with pipe inspections
We'll use one of our state-of-the-art drain cameras for a quick, yet rigorous, pipe inspection. Our cameras let us look at your home's plumbing from the inside out, and find the broken section of pipe.

Low-impact repair methods
If the damage is localized, we can use pipe bursting, pipe lining, or sectional point repair techniques for your sewer repair. These methods let us pull new pipe or lining through existing sewer pipes, avoiding digging up your whole yard.

Sewer line excavation
If you need widespread repairs, we might need to excavate your sewer line. This typically involves digging a trench down to the sewer line, then repairing or replacing it in a more hands-on fashion.

Sewer Cleanout Installation
You can also preemptively fight against future sewer problems by installing a sewer cleanout. A sewer cleanout is a convenient access point to your sewer line that can help with future sewer repairs, minimizing their disruption.

Dangers of Damaged Sewer Lines in Affton

A broken sewer line isn't just gross – the problems don't stop at the pipes. When you take too long to fix your sewer line, you're risking the following:

Health Hazards
You likely already know that sewage is full of harmful waste products. Organisms, viruses, and parasites are typically contained in your sewer lines. These can include Hepatitis A, Salmonella, dysentery, and E. coli. Leaks risks exposing you to each of these, whether you walk into a wastewater puddle, a drip falls into a cut, or even if you just inhale the fumes.

Property Damage
The damage doesn't stop at your sewer line. Cracks to pipes in your walls and under your floors can cause wet rot, which will eat away at the structure of your house. And even more dangerous, when it comes into contact with electricity, it can cause short circuits and permanent damage. Should it leak onto your furniture, you'll likely be looking for replacements.

Environmental Harm
As the sewage spreads, the pollution creates harm for the environment. In rivers, it can harm fish populations, while on land, animals are are exposed to the same bacteria, viruses, and parasites as we listed above. On top of that, some of the algae that feed on wastewater give off toxins, exacerbating the damage.

Pest Attraction
Infestations are attracted to the nutrients in wastewater. If you're noticing wet spots in your yard, you should be extra careful of this: Pests can enter the line through damage in the pipe, then climb up into your home. In Missouri, common pest infestations include bed bugs, rats, and termites.
